    ""Richelieu In Love Or The Youth Of Charles I"" is a historical comedy play written by Emma Robinson in 1844. The play is set in the 17th century and follows the story of the young Charles I, who falls in love with a French woman named Julie de Mortemar. However, their romance is complicated by the political machinations of Cardinal Richelieu, who is determined to use Julie as a pawn in his schemes to gain power and influence.The play is divided into five acts and features a cast of colorful characters, including the scheming Richelieu, the lovestruck Charles I, the beautiful Julie, and a host of other historical figures from the era. The play is filled with witty dialogue, romantic subplots, and political intrigue, making it a thrilling and entertaining read for anyone interested in historical fiction.Overall, ""Richelieu In Love Or The Youth Of Charles I"" is a well-written and engaging play that offers a unique perspective on the lives and loves of some of history's most fascinating figures.
